Welcome to Doom9's Forum, THE in-place to be for everyone interested in DVD conversion.

Before you start posting please read the forum rules. By posting to this forum you agree to abide by the rules.

 

Go Back   Doom9's Forum > General > DVD2AVI / DGIndex

Reply
 
Thread Tools Search this Thread Display Modes
Old 25th August 2009, 21:41   #261  |  Link
Revgen
Registered User
 
Join Date: Sep 2004
Location: Near LA, California, USA
Posts: 1,545
^Yer Welcome
__________________
Pirate: Now how would you like to die? Would you like to have your head chopped off or be burned at the stake?

Curly: Burned at the stake!

Moe: Why?

Curly: A hot steak is always better than a cold chop.
Revgen is offline   Reply With Quote
Old 26th August 2009, 03:37   #262  |  Link
SomeJoe
Registered User
 
Join Date: Jan 2003
Posts: 315
Quote:
Originally Posted by neuron2 View Post
Here is NV beta 8. It has full D3D-less operation, revision of the cropping functionality as discussed, and a few minor bug fixes.

I'd appreciate hearing whether screensaver/standby activation still cause problems.
http://neuron2.net/dgavcdecnv/NVbeta8.zip

I use a remote desktop solution by the name of LogMeIn on both of my desktops. With all previous DGNV tools, you could not change the state of a remote session while the CUVID server was running, or you would get a crash of the CUVID server with the CUVIDMapFrame() error.

By change the state, I mean that you could start the CUVID server and start an encode locally, but then remoting into the machine would crash it. Or, you could start the CUVID server inside a remote session and start an encode, but if you disconnected the remote session, it would crash.

With beta 8, I can now log into and out of remote sessions at will with the CUVID server running with no problems.

LogMeIn installs a special "mirror video driver" that mirrors the current local desktop into the remote session. It was the insertion/removal of this driver's functionality each time a remote session was started/ended that would cause CUVID to crash.

Very happy with this development. LogMeIn remote sessions time out after a certain amount of inactivity, and I can't tell you how many encodes I lost because a remote session timed out when I wasn't paying attention.
__________________
- SomeJoe
SomeJoe is offline   Reply With Quote
Old 26th August 2009, 03:52   #263  |  Link
Guest
Guest
 
Join Date: Jan 2002
Posts: 21,901
That's really great news. Thanks, sharing is caring.
Guest is offline   Reply With Quote
Old 26th August 2009, 09:33   #264  |  Link
GZZ
Registered User
 
Join Date: Jan 2002
Posts: 581
---------------------------
Warning
---------------------------
ERROR: cuInit failed (100)

Hit Yes to continue notifying this specific error type; hit No to disable it.
Hit Cancel to suppress all further errors.
---------------------------
Yes No Cancel
---------------------------

I get this message, men I try to open DGAVCIndexNV from Beta 8. It have worked previously (yesterday), but I have tried to restart 3 times now, the next thing is to reinstall my nvidia driver (this will 99.9% fix the issue). Its not the first time I have got this error, but it always happen when opening a AVS file that use the cuvidserver (beta 7), but now (beta 8) I also get this when opening DGAVCIndexNV. Previously I also rebooted (worked must of the time), but know I properly have to reinstall my nvidia driver. Any idea why ?
GZZ is offline   Reply With Quote
Old 26th August 2009, 14:10   #265  |  Link
Guest
Guest
 
Join Date: Jan 2002
Posts: 21,901
Sorry, I've no idea. I assume you don't have old DLLs lying around and you have Nvidia 190.62.

I'll ask Nvidia about it as it would appear to be a side-effect of going D3D-less.
Guest is offline   Reply With Quote
Old 26th August 2009, 14:48   #266  |  Link
Varies
Registered User
 
Join Date: Aug 2008
Posts: 64
I had a problem with detect/demux AAC stream from TS and PCM stream from VOB, however non-nv DGIndex detect it fine.

Quote:
Beta 8. Cropping Filter. Use this option to crop your video.
Why I should crop 4 pixels, if I have a blackborder 0.5-1 px?
you may write cropping like in BilinearResize(864,480,1,2,-3,-1) ?

__________________
message transgoogled :)
Varies is offline   Reply With Quote
Old 26th August 2009, 15:03   #267  |  Link
Efenstor
Registered User
 
Join Date: Aug 2008
Location: Krasnoyarsk, Russian Federation
Posts: 90
Quote:
Originally Posted by neuron2 View Post
Post a link to the first two files.
Three files is better:

http://www.efenstor.net/external/00066.MTS
http://www.efenstor.net/external/00067.MTS
http://www.efenstor.net/external/00068.MTS

P.S.: it's about the audio sync problem, if you remember.
Efenstor is offline   Reply With Quote
Old 26th August 2009, 15:04   #268  |  Link
GZZ
Registered User
 
Join Date: Jan 2002
Posts: 581
Quote:
Originally Posted by neuron2 View Post
Sorry, I've no idea. I assume you don't have old DLLs lying around and you have Nvidia 190.62.

I'll ask Nvidia about it as it would appear to be a side-effect of going D3D-less.

Maybe. I was using it to encode 3 movies and they all did a good job, but I have found out that sometimes when you terminate your cuvidserver bare right click and exit it dosnt shutdown properly and still hangs in task manager. But if you kill it from the taskmanager, then it works just fine afterwards.

But this time its completly broken, I tried to reinstall Nvidia driver (190.62) and it still gives me the same error when trying to start DGAVCIndexNV or the CUVIDServer so something in my Nvidia driver has broken, will try to reinstall later tonight and see if I can get it working again.

Also found out that if you have the CUVIDserver running and have another process to access the GPU (another AVS that uses the cuvidserver) (I know its not working yet) then shutting down the cuvidserver afterwards using the right click and exit it will hang and properly give this error when trying to start the cuvidserver again, then only a reboot will work. Not sure if this can be reproduce, but I will try if I can 'break' it again and give an update.
GZZ is offline   Reply With Quote
Old 26th August 2009, 15:11   #269  |  Link
Guest
Guest
 
Join Date: Jan 2002
Posts: 21,901
Quote:
Originally Posted by Varies View Post
I had a problem with detect/demux AAC stream from TS and PCM stream from VOB, however non-nv DGIndex detect it fine.
For the AAC in TS, it should be working, post a link to an unprocessed source sample. For the PCM in VOB, it's not supported yet. I will add it.

Quote:
Why I should crop 4 pixels, if I have a blackborder 0.5-1 px?
you may write cropping like in BilinearResize(864,480,1,2,-3,-1) ?
You may crop/resize as you like on GPU or CPU; nobody is holding a gun to your head. But if you want to use GPU resizing, then you typically need to do the cropping on the GPU too, so that it happens before the resizing. I am limited to what the NVCUVID API supports for cropping functionality.
Guest is offline   Reply With Quote
Old 26th August 2009, 15:18   #270  |  Link
Guest
Guest
 
Join Date: Jan 2002
Posts: 21,901
Quote:
Originally Posted by Efenstor View Post
P.S.: it's about the audio sync problem, if you remember.
I had a similar problem with all the M2TSs on Ratatouille BD. Each M2TS has slightly different audio/video lengths and that accumulates as the movie plays. I finally did a timestretch on the full audio track but that is obviously a kludge. I'll have to think about how to handle such cases.
Guest is offline   Reply With Quote
Old 26th August 2009, 15:37   #271  |  Link
Varies
Registered User
 
Join Date: Aug 2008
Posts: 64
Link to an unprocessed source sample where not detected AAC stream
__________________
message transgoogled :)
Varies is offline   Reply With Quote
Old 26th August 2009, 15:53   #272  |  Link
GZZ
Registered User
 
Join Date: Jan 2002
Posts: 581
An update to my isssue, I got the error:
Quote:
ERROR: cuInit failed (100)
when I tested it from working using remote desktop (windows XP built in remote desktop), know when I'm home its working just fine again. Not sure if its related to this one:
Quote:
I'd appreciate hearing whether screensaver/standby activation still cause problems.
GZZ is offline   Reply With Quote
Old 28th August 2009, 02:04   #273  |  Link
Guest
Guest
 
Join Date: Jan 2002
Posts: 21,901
Quote:
Originally Posted by 7ekno View Post
I am also having issues with "AVCHDlite" streams from Panasonic ...
OK, I figured it out. It's pretty simple. The frame duplication is signalled with pic timing SEIs with a frame structure 7, which means frame doubling. I currently don't support that, so until I do, the script workarounds I gave are fine.
Guest is offline   Reply With Quote
Old 29th August 2009, 06:55   #274  |  Link
Guest
Guest
 
Join Date: Jan 2002
Posts: 21,901
Quote:
Originally Posted by Revgen View Post
DGMPGIndexNV is not properly indexing the VOB files from my Dance Fools Dance dvd. DGIndex is doing it correctly. The video is 144793 frames, but virtualdub only loads 144389 frames from the .dgm file.
My DVD arrived. That's a cool movie!

Anyway, the problem was that the stream contains lots of instances of declared video pes packets but with no payload. After the video start code, instead of some video data in the packet, the packet just ends with nothing and there is a stuffing packet instead. This is highly unusual (otherwise we'd have heard about it before now). Anyway, it was easy to add a check for no payload (as in DGIndex) and just skip it. With that fix, the number of frames reported is 144793 as expected.

The fix will be in the next beta, which is imminent.
Guest is offline   Reply With Quote
Old 29th August 2009, 15:47   #275  |  Link
Guest
Guest
 
Join Date: Jan 2002
Posts: 21,901
NV beta 9

NV beta 9 is released. It has a lot of fixes.

http://neuron2.net/dgavcdecnv/NVbeta9.zip

Have you guys noticed how the CPU utilization is way down with D3D-less operation? I use 2-4% on a full HD decode, where before I had 14-15%. DGIndex maxs out one core.

Last edited by Guest; 29th August 2009 at 16:24.
Guest is offline   Reply With Quote
Old 29th August 2009, 20:45   #276  |  Link
laserfan
Aging Video Hobbyist
 
Join Date: Dec 2004
Location: Off the Map
Posts: 2,461
Re: "Dance Fools Dance":

Quote:
Originally Posted by neuron2 View Post
My DVD arrived. That's a cool movie!
And a cool response--I'm impressed, you bought the movie and fixed the problem already!!!

I'd thought those "On Demand" Warner DVDs were made "on demand" i.e. not stocked yet you got it in 4 days!? Very slick, I will have to look more closely at their website.
laserfan is offline   Reply With Quote
Old 29th August 2009, 21:10   #277  |  Link
creamyhorror
Registered User
 
Join Date: Mar 2008
Posts: 118
Thanks, going to try it out...tomorrow morning.
creamyhorror is offline   Reply With Quote
Old 29th August 2009, 23:53   #278  |  Link
GZZ
Registered User
 
Join Date: Jan 2002
Posts: 581
I really like the "Multiple instance are not allowed" so it dosnt kill the cuvidserver when its already processing a movie. Looking forward to a beta with multiple instance allowed. But the current warning is great for the time being.
GZZ is offline   Reply With Quote
Old 30th August 2009, 01:11   #279  |  Link
Guest
Guest
 
Join Date: Jan 2002
Posts: 21,901
Please re-download beta 9 as the info log feature was busted in all the indexers.

@laserfan

I was shocked to see it arrive so fast too. And by snail mail. Took me 8 hours to debug. I went down a lot of false paths until I realized some video PES packets were empty.

@GZZ

Glad you like that check. Naughty of you to make it happen, though. You should obey my warnings!

@all

BTW, I added LPCM audio support (demux to synced WAV as in DGIndex) to DGMPGDecNV for program streams (typically VOBs).

Last edited by Guest; 30th August 2009 at 01:14.
Guest is offline   Reply With Quote
Old 30th August 2009, 08:06   #280  |  Link
Revgen
Registered User
 
Join Date: Sep 2004
Location: Near LA, California, USA
Posts: 1,545
Quote:
Originally Posted by neuron2 View Post
My DVD arrived. That's a cool movie!

Anyway, the problem was that the stream contains lots of instances of declared video pes packets but with no payload. After the video start code, instead of some video data in the packet, the packet just ends with nothing and there is a stuffing packet instead. This is highly unusual (otherwise we'd have heard about it before now). Anyway, it was easy to add a check for no payload (as in DGIndex) and just skip it. With that fix, the number of frames reported is 144793 as expected.

The fix will be in the next beta, which is imminent.
I'm glad you liked the movie. Not too bad for an early talkie.

The fix works on my end too, so that's good.

These discs aren't conventional discs, so I'm not too surprised that they have errors that you wouldn't expect from traditional commercial DVD's. I will be getting more WB Archive titles, so hopefully there aren't anymore problems.
__________________
Pirate: Now how would you like to die? Would you like to have your head chopped off or be burned at the stake?

Curly: Burned at the stake!

Moe: Why?

Curly: A hot steak is always better than a cold chop.

Last edited by Revgen; 30th August 2009 at 08:15.
Revgen is offline   Reply With Quote
Reply

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ump


All times are GMT +1. The time now is 05:25.


Powered by vBulletin® Version 3.8.11
Copyright ©2000 - 2024, vBulletin Solutions Inc.